I've got a wrtsl54gs, not a straight 54g, but here's my /etc/config/wireless (with my local wireless info replaced with all caps):

config wifi-device  wl0
        option type     broadcom
        option channel  MYCHANNELNO
# disable radio to prevent an open ap after reflashing:
        option disabled 0

config wifi-iface
        option device   wl0
        option network  wan
        option mode     sta
        option ssid     MYSSID
        option hidden   0
        option encryption none

Here's my /etc/config/network:

#### VLAN configuration 
config switch eth0
        option vlan0    "0 1 2 3 4 5u"


#### Loopback configuration
config interface loopback
        option ifname   "lo"
        option proto    static
        option ipaddr   127.0.0.1
        option netmask  255.0.0.0


#### LAN configuration
config interface lan
        option type     bridge
        option ifname   "eth0"
        option macaddr  "00:18:F8:BD:8E:0B"
        option proto    static
        option ipaddr   192.168.1.1
        option netmask  255.255.255.0


#### WAN configuration
config interface        wan
        option ifname   "eth2"
        option macaddr  "00:18:f8:bd:8e:0c"
        option proto    dhcp

Btw, the salient differences is that you've still got your wireless on your lan (which is typically configured statically) whereas I've got mine on the wan (which is configured via dhcp). I can't imagine why you'd want your wifi to be a client if it's not your wan (i.e. upstream internet connection), so that might be your problem.

Note: if you're trying to configure your wifi as a bridge (i.e. "wet" rather than "sta"), my guess is that you'll want to leave it on the lan. I don't know how to change the various scripts to get that to work, though.

Here's my config files, running routed client mode on my WRT54GL 1.1 ... pretty much the same as ctl's setup:

/etc/config/network

config switch eth0
        option vlan0    "0 1 2 3 4 5*"

config interface loopback
        option ifname   "lo"
        option proto    static
        option ipaddr   127.0.0.1
        option netmask  255.0.0.0

config interface lan
        option type     bridge
        option ifname   "eth0.0"
        option proto    static
        option ipaddr   192.168.2.1
        option netmask  255.255.255.0

config interface wan
        option ifname   wl0
        option proto    dhcp

/etc/config/wireless

config wifi-device wl0
        option type             broadcom
        option disabled         0

config wifi-iface
        option device           wl0
        option network          wan
        option mode             sta
        option ssid             linksys

Duon wrote:
config interface wan
        option ifname   wl0
        option proto    dhcp

Bad example.

Don't use "option ifname" to specify a wireless interface.

The names of the wireless interfaces are dynamically assigned and should not be hardcoded. Instead you should remove the "option ifname wl0" in your /etc/config/network and replace it with a "option network wan" in your /etc/config/wireless, which will configure the wireless interface as per the "wan" section.

(Yes, you can have a config section in /etc/config/network without an ifname)

mbm,

I already have "option network wan" in my wireless config, and once I removed the "option ifname wl0" line from network, I could no longer connect.  What did I miss? hmm

Duon: You have not missed anything. You MUST include the ifname in case of the wireless wan configuration until all other applications and scripts are fixed.

mbm: The idea of the dynamic wireless config is clever. But all applications and scripts in OpenWrt expects the ifname in the network config in case of the wan interface. There are many of the scripts that cannot work without setting the ifname in the interface section, for example firewall, miniupnpd and other init scripts requiring the wan interface. The /lib/network/config.sh, scan_interfaces() does not take the dynamic wireless configuration into account.

Well, I didn’t receive any help but I did get it working. Un-said in my first post, I wanted to do this in a script. I wanted to keep my regular configs when the router was at home and script the “routed client mode�  when at the cottage. My failing was not dropping the firewall and restarting it.

I think this method is simpler then what ctl or duon is using if your trying to setup “routed client mode�  within a script. The reason, no switch changes are necessary, the lan side stays static and if connected via ssh, you can run the script without being disconnected or the necessity of rebooting.

So, here goes;

#!/bin/sh

if test $# -eq 0
then echo ""
     echo "Select Wireless Network to Join"
     echo "Option: Enter Network ESSID"
     echo ""
     exit
fi

/etc/init.d/firewall stop
ifdown wan
wifi down
uci set wireless.cfg2.ssid=$1
uci set wireless.cfg2.mode=sta
uci set wireless.cfg2.encryption=none
uci set wireless.cfg2.network=wan
uci set network.wan.proto=dhcp
uci set network.wan.type=bridge
ifup wan
wifi up
/etc/init.d/firewall start

This sets up a bridge (br-wan) between eth0.1 & wl0 and sets the IP on the bridge. The script also assumes you have the wireless running as an access point and your connecting to an open access point. You will need more wireless settings if your connecting to an encrypted network. Probably some of these;

option encryption  wep, psk, psk2, wpa, wpa2
option key encryption key
option key1 key 1
option key2 key 2
option key3 key 3
option key4 key 4

The basic script, gives the same rip-off features to join a network, as Blue Box.

I hope this helps others.

P.S. - please note, I don't "uci commit" anywhere in the script. That way the changes only exist between reboots and only when the script is run.

WDS works fine with this method. Again, this assumes the router is configured as a standard AP before running the script.

#!/bin/sh

wifi down
uci set wireless.cfg2.ssid={ SSID of the other router }
uci set wireless.cfg2.bssid={ MAC address of the other router }
uci set wireless.cfg3=wifi-iface
uci set wireless.cfg3.TYPE=wifi-iface
uci set wireless.cfg3.device=wl0
uci set wireless.cfg3.network=lan
uci set wireless.cfg3.mode=wds
uci set wireless.cfg3.ssid=wds
uci set wireless.cfg3.bssid={ MAC address of the other router }
wifi up
echo ""
echo "Router is now running in the WDS mode"
echo ""

Both routers have to be on the same channel and it's more seamless when they share the same SSID.

Kamikaze 7.09 does not seem to have the same issue as mentioned in the other thread. This version brings up the wds0.1 interface and assigns it to the br-lan bridge

Tested between a WRT54GL running Kamikaze 7.09 and a WRT54GS v7 running DD-WRT v24 RC-6 (01/02/08) micro - build 8743
